About [2-[1-(5-tert-butyl-1,3-oxazol-2-yl)ethylsulfonyl]-3-methylimidazol-4-yl]methanol
[2-[1-(5-tert-butyl-1,3-oxazol-2-yl)ethylsulfonyl]-3-methylimidazol-4-yl]methanol (PubChem CID 75497616) has the molecular formula C14H21N3O4S
and a molecular weight of 327.41 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is [2-[1-(5-tert-butyl-1,3-oxazol-2-yl)ethylsulfonyl]-3-methylimidazol-4-yl]methanol.

What is the SMILES notation for [2-[1-(5-tert-butyl-1,3-oxazol-2-yl)ethylsulfonyl]-3-methylimidazol-4-yl]methanol?
The canonical SMILES for [2-[1-(5-tert-butyl-1,3-oxazol-2-yl)ethylsulfonyl]-3-methylimidazol-4-yl]methanol is CC(c1ncc(C(C)(C)C)o1)S(=O)(=O)c1ncc(CO)n1C.
What is the InChIKey of [2-[1-(5-tert-butyl-1,3-oxazol-2-yl)ethylsulfonyl]-3-methylimidazol-4-yl]methanol?
The InChIKey is LTYKVMHNLLIIAE-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C14H21N3O4S/c1-9(12-15-7-11(21-12)14(2,3)4)22(19,20)13-16-6-10(8-18)17(13)5/h6-7,9,18H,8H2,1-5H3.
What are the key properties of [2-[1-(5-tert-butyl-1,3-oxazol-2-yl)ethylsulfonyl]-3-methylimidazol-4-yl]methanol?
[2-[1-(5-tert-butyl-1,3-oxazol-2-yl)ethylsulfonyl]-3-methylimidazol-4-yl]methanol has a molecular weight of 327.41 g/mol, XLogP of 1.73, 4 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 7 hydrogen bond acceptors.
